Orland Properties Ltd Sells 2,000,000 Shares of XPeng Inc. (NYSE:XPEV)

XPeng logo with Auto/Tires/Trucks background

Orland Properties Ltd trimmed its holdings in XPeng Inc. (NYSE:XPEV - Free Report) by 56.7%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 1,524,462 shares of the company's stock after selling 2,000,000 shares during the period. XPeng accounts for 26.3% of Orland Properties Ltd's holdings, making the stock its largest position. Orland Properties Ltd owned 0.16% of XPeng worth $18,019,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

XPeng Company Profile

(Free Report)

XPeng Inc designs, develops, manufactures, and markets smart electric vehicles (EVs) in the People's Republic of China. It offers SUVs under the G3, G3i, and G9 names; four-door sports sedans under the P7 and P7i names; and family sedans under the P5 name. The company also provides sales contracts, super charging, maintenance, technical support, auto financing, insurance, technology support, ride-hailing, automotive loan referral, and other services, as well as vehicle leasing and insurance agency services.
